You have worked in an industrial sector, ideally in aerospace, and you want to grow and develop new skills? This position is for you!

The A220 commercial aircraft program is looking for a Methods Agent to join our operations support team based in Mirabel, Quebec, Canada.

You will be part of the PRE-FAL team , responsible for producing aircraft components delivered to the two FALs of the A220 program, one in Mirabel and the other in Mobile. The team’s structure is designed to promote cross-functional collaboration autonomously, providing mutual support and learning collectively.

Your Work Environment:

The A220 commercial aircraft program headquarters is located in Mirabel, in the metropolitan Montreal area, just steps away from the vibrant city of Montreal. Known for its peaceful and safe environment, the region offers a great quality of life for young professionals, experienced professionals, and families alike, balancing career opportunities with outdoor activities, making it a truly special place to live.

Your role as a Methods Agent will be to support the autonomous work cells / EAPs and ensure that technical issues are resolved efficiently and swiftly to minimize impacts on operations.

In your role, you will be called upon to:

Participate in, maintain, and improve the manufacturing strategy and plan for the A220 Pre-FAL.

Manage complex projects leading to product improvement and/or reduction of assembly cycles as well as ramp-up projects.

Coordinate activities during the different phases of assigned projects.

Align the work of involved resources and be the interface between various stakeholders.

Manage client expectations and change requests within projects.

Prepare and present project status reports to the management committee.

Define the strategy for executing your projects: content, scope, resources, timelines, costs, risks, quality management, communications, and training.

Manage budgets and expenses related to assigned projects.

Participate in cross-functional teams to establish and maintain the best assembly strategy.

Evaluate, participate in, and support continuous improvement initiatives related to aircraft assembly processes.
